Supportnet / Forum / Skripte(PHP,ASP,Perl...)
Sambar Webserver - WebBoard
Frage
Ich betreibe ein Intranet mit dem Sambar-Server 6.2 unter WindowsNT.
Bei der Bastelei zur Einbindung des Server-internen WebBoards ist mir ein kleines Problem aufgefallen:
Das Script registriert die falsche Uhrzeit der Postings.
Eingetragen wird anstatt 15:55 13:55 Uhr. Ist nicht weiter schlimm, aber schöner wär´s schon.
Hier die entsprechende Passage aus dem ASP-Quelltext:
[code]dbcommand(dbm, "INSERT INTO " + topictable + " (id, replies, date, subject, username, post, icon) VALUES (NULL, 0, [b] datetime(´now´)[/b], ´" + sqlescape(subj) + "´, ´" + aut + "´, ´" + sqlescape(desc) + "´, ´" + sqlescape(icon) + "´)");
[/code]
An der Serverzeit kann es nicht liegen. Auf der Admin-Seite des Webservers wird die korrekte Uhrzeit angezeigt. Ein Test mit verstellter Systemzeit des PC´s hat ergeben, dass die Systemzeit direkten Einfluss auf das gespeicherte Datum hat. Nur eben mit zwei Stunden Differenz. :-(
Ht jemand ne Idee, woran das liegen könnte oder wie die zwei Stunden wieder draufgerechnet werden können?
Gruss Flupo
Antwort 1 von Flupo
Neue Erkenntnisse: Das Problem muss an der Einstellung der Zeitzone liegen.
Da ich im Bereich ASP ein absoluter Anfänger bin, hab ich keine Ahnung mit welchem Befehl ich die Zeitzone von GMT auf MESZ umstellen kann.
Wer ist schlauer?
Gruss Flupo
Da ich im Bereich ASP ein absoluter Anfänger bin, hab ich keine Ahnung mit welchem Befehl ich die Zeitzone von GMT auf MESZ umstellen kann.
Wer ist schlauer?
Gruss Flupo
Antwort 2 von ASPler
versuch mal ein
Aber ich glaube nicht das es Dein Problem lösen wird
Es gibt bei den Datum Sachen die merkwürdigsten Ursachen...
Manchmal kann es z.B. daran liegen, dass das Installierte Windows z.B. Englisch ist und das Tastaturlayout Deutsch.
<% @ LCID=1031%>
am Anfang der Seite zu setzten.Aber ich glaube nicht das es Dein Problem lösen wird
Es gibt bei den Datum Sachen die merkwürdigsten Ursachen...
Manchmal kann es z.B. daran liegen, dass das Installierte Windows z.B. Englisch ist und das Tastaturlayout Deutsch.
Antwort 3 von Flupo
Das war´s leider nicht. Der Sambar verwendet eine eigene Scriptsprache (CScript) und bringt einen Syntaxfehler (unexpected Token). Die Doku dazu ist leider nicht sehr ausführlich.
Danke trotzdem.
Gruss Flupo
Danke trotzdem.
Gruss Flupo